I caught some, but not all, of the annual state Quiz Bowl finals on AETN last weekend. It’s great fun watching Arkansas high school students answer mind-bending math questions and pull esoteric facts out of their hats.
So congrats to this year’s state champions:
Class 1A — Haas Hall, which beat LISA Academy
Class 2A — Woodlawn, which beat Parkers Chapel
Class 3A — Bauxite, which beat Episcopal Collegiate
Class 4A — Huntsville, which beat Subiaco Academy
Class 5A — Little Rock Christian, which beat Morrilton
Class 6A — Little Rock Parkview, which beat Benton
Class 7A — Little Rock Central, which beat Cabot.
MVPs in each division included, ta da, Arkansas Times Academic All-Star Chris Mullen of Little Rock Christian. A number of other all-stars participated in final-round games.
Speaking of academic achievement: LR Central’s team in the Fed Challenge, a Federal Reserve Bank competition, again won the regional championship and again will advance to national competition. Teams win by presenting an analysis of the national economy and make a monetary policy recommendation to the Fed’s Open Markets Committee. It ain’t tiddlywinks.
